Rifatturazzioni di codice

Usu commerciale OK 380+ mudelli Nessuna filigrana Nudda iscrizioni necessaria
Modellu:
+ GPT-5, Claude, Gemini
Incolla u codice è otteni una versione rifatturizzata — nomi più puliti, funzioni estratte, schemi idiomatichi, duppiatura rimossa. Sceglite un scopu di rifatturizazione per guidà e priorità. Ritorna una diff side-by-side più una raggiunamentu per cambiamentu. Funziona in più di 16 lingue.
Comportamentu priservatu
Ctrl+Enter pi inviari · Tab inserisce spazzi 0 / 10,000

Lascia un fugliale di sorgenti — finu a 500KB. Lu incollamu ntô campu di codice.

Acquista token
Incolla u codice da rifatturà.
Codice rifatturizatu

        
Changes + rationale
Opzioni avanzate
Risurtatu
Tokens scarsi. Più token
Volete risultati megghiu? Modelli Premium (GPT-5, Claude, Gemini) offrenu una qualità cchiù àuta. Visualizza i piani

❤️ Amuri Free.ai? Dì i vostri amichi!

Iscriviti per ottene un ligame di rifirimentu è guadagnà 25.000 gettoni per amicu.

Volete di più? Iscriviti gratuitamente per 30K tokens/day + 10K bonus
Iscriviti

Elaborazione di a vostra richiesta...

Refactor è ottimizà u codice cù AI libera. Codice più pulitu, più veloce, più mantenibile.

Comu usari Rifatturazzioni di codice

1
Inserisci u vostru input

Scrivi un testu, carica un figghiu o discrivi chiddu ca vogghiu. Nudda cuntu necessariu.

2
Clicca pi generari

A nostra IA processa a vostra dumanda in uni pochi di seconde usannu i migliori mudelli open-source.

3
Scarica e cunnividi

Scarica, copia o sparte u vostru risultatu. Libru per usu persunale è cummerciale.

Usa stu strumentu via API

Automate stu strumentu da u vostru propiu codice. OpenAI-compatible REST endpoint, Bearer-token auth, no extra SDK richiestu. Token costi currisponde à l'interfaccia web.

curl -X POST https://api.free.ai/v1/chat/ \
  -H "Authorization: Bearer sk-free-..." \
  -H "Content-Type: application/json" \
  -d '{"model": "qwen-coder", "messages": [{"role": "user", "content": "Write a Python function that reverses a string."}]}'

Rifatturazzioni di codice — FAQ

Incolla u codice, sceglite un obiettivu di refactor (legibilità / modernizà / tipi / test-first / prestazioni / DRY / SOLID / asincronu / gestione di l'errori), ripiglià una versione refactored più una ragionalità per cambiamentu è un diff side-by-side.

Rivisioni DIAGNOSI (risultati classificati pi gravità). Rifatturamentu FISSAZIONI — vi duna u còdici riscrittu. Usa Rivisioni pi dicìdiri si rifatturà; usa Rifatturamentu pi fàllu.

Sì — chistu è u cuntrattu. "Manteni i firme API pubbliche" e "Non rompere i test esistenti" sò marcati di manera predefinita; u mudellu deve pruduciri una dichjarazione di cunservazione di cumpurtamentu chì cunfermi o segnali ogni cambiamentu semànticu.

Liggibbilità (nomi cchiù chiari, fns cchiù picculi), Modernizza (idiomi attuali + stdlib), Sicurità di tipu (annotazioni), Tests-first (puru + DI), Prestazioni (complessità + allocazione), Rimuovi duppiatura, SOLID, Async-ify, Gestione di l'errori.

No — leggi sempre a diff prima di incollà. U mudellu è forti a riscrizzioni idiomatica ma pò occasionalmenti canciari u cumpurtamentu in casi di edge. Esegui i vostri test; a vista diff faci a revisione rapida.

Qwen 3 Coder hè u predefinitu - veloce è curretta in ~ 95% di i refactors. DeepSeek R1 per riscrizzioni multi-centu-linea di raggiunamentu profondu. Premium Claude Sonnet 4 / GPT-5 per riscrizzioni di file interi in logica di affari cumplessa.

I rifatturi JetBrains sunnu deterministichi (rinomina, estratta, sposta classa). Free.ai Refactor è GENERATIVU — riscrivi u codice in modi ca i rifatturi IDE nun ponnu, comu a modernizzazzioni idiomatica o a testabilità di punta à punta. Usa tutti dui.

Copilot edit hè un IDE in linea, singulatu, veloci. Free.ai Refactor hè basatu supra un navigaturi è vi dà una lista strutturata di ragiunamenti + diff + follow-ups, più 9 modi di scopu da sceglie. Copilot per u flussu; Free.ai per pensà à u refactor.

Fiancu a fiancu cu li linii livati in rossu (--), li linii novi in virdi (+), li linii nun canciati in grigiu. Cliccate Diff supra lu pannellu di risultati pi comutari; passate a Rifatturizatu pi un codice novu pulitu, Origginali pi l'input.

Sì — cliccate Origginali ntô scànciavisualizzaturi o "Rifabbricari un'autra" pi riinizializzari. L'utilità nun applica mai i canciamenti automaticamenti; vi tocca a voi a incollà chiddu ca sceglite.

U codice hè mandatu ô mudellu, processatu, è scartatu. Ùn hè micca sarbatu, nè usatu pi l'addestramentu. Pi la massima privacy sceglite Qwen 3 Coder (auto-ospitatu supra li nostri GPU - nun lassa mai i nostri servitori).

Sì — POST a /v1/chat/ cu nu prompt di sistema ca discrivi lu vostru scopu di refactor + li restrizzioni e u codice comu messaggiu di l'utilizaturi. Vedi /api/ pi la spec. completa.

Iscriviti gratuitamenti pi 10.000 tokens

Crea un contu

Nessuna carta di creditu richiesta

Comu valutate stu strumentu?

Amuri Free.ai? Dì i vostri amichi!